一、問題背景
PbootCMS 后臺默認情況下,文章列表每頁顯示的最大數量為 200 條。然而,在實際的網站運營過程中,可能會有用戶需要每頁顯示更多數量的文章,以便更高效地管理大量內容。此時,就需要對后臺相關代碼進行修改。
二、修改步驟
1. 定位目標文件
打開 PbootCMS 項目中的 apps\admin\view\default\content\content.html
文件。該文件負責后臺文章列表頁面的顯示邏輯。
2. 查找關鍵代碼段
在 content.html
文件中,使用文本編輯器的搜索功能,搜索 “每頁顯示數量”。找到類似以下的代碼部分:
<option value="{url./admin/Content/index/mcode/'.get('mcode').'/pagesize/200}" {if(get('pagesize')==200)}selected{/if}>200條/頁</option>
3. 增加新的顯示數量選項
在上述代碼的下方繼續添加新的選項,例如要增加每頁顯示 1000 條的選項,可添加如下代碼:
<option value="{:url('/admin/Content/index', ['mcode' => request()->get('mcode')])}?pagesize=1000" {if request()->get('pagesize') == 1000}selected{/if}>1000 條/頁</option>
這里可以根據實際需求,將 1000
修改為其他所需的數值。
4. 保存文件并驗證效果
完成代碼修改后,保存 content.html
文件。然后刷新后臺文章列表頁面,查看下拉菜單中是否已經出現新增的每頁顯示數量選項,選擇該選項后,檢查文章列表每頁顯示的數量是否符合預期。